At a Hallmark store you can find several different product lines of greeting cards, likely including Fresh Ink, Nature's Sketchbook, Shoebox, Maxine, Mahogany, and Tree of Life cards—all made by Hallmark for sale in its stores and intended to appeal to different target markets. The Mahogany line is designed to appeal to African-Americans. This is an example of __________ segmentation.

Answer:

It is an example of demographic segmentation.

Step-by-step explanation:

To start with, demographics is the study of a population (especially a human population) on the basis of factors that include race, age, gender, households, families, ethnicity,education, income e.t.c.

Thus, demographic segmentation is a market segmentation based on factors that include race, age, gender, households, families, ethnicity, education, income e.t.c.

This kind of segmentation helps an organization or business like Hallmark store (from the question) to accurately target its customers and effectively satisfy their needs.
